Global Technical Q&A

What are the primary advantages of NPT 3/4 threads over Metric M25 for global projects?
NPT 3/4 (National Pipe Thread) features a 60-degree thread angle and a tapered design, which creates a mechanical "interference fit" seal. This is the standard for most North American industrial enclosures. Metric threads (like M25) are parallel and rely entirely on an O-ring for sealing. Using NPT 3/4 ensures compliance with US and Canadian electrical codes (NEC/CEC).

What is the expected service life of a nylon vs. metal cable gland in outdoor environments?
Our PA66 Nylon glands are UV-stabilized and typically last 10-15 years in moderate climates. For extreme marine or industrial environments, our Nickel-Plated Brass or 316 Stainless Steel glands are recommended, offering a service life exceeding 25 years with superior corrosion resistance.
